(Cedar County) Two people suffered injuries in a single-vehicle accident in Cedar County.
The Iowa State Patrol reports that the crash occurred early Sunday morning at 81 Main Street. Authorities identified the two injured people as 23-year-old Blake J. Johnson, of Aledo, Illinois, and 20-year-old Adam Dean Duncan of Lowden, Iowa.
According to the report, Johnson was driving a 2013 Audi A6, left the roadway, entered the parking lot, and struck a parked semi.
Tipton Ambulance transported Blake Johnson to the UIHC. Clarence Ambulance transferred 20-year-old Adam Dean Duncan to UIHC.
The accident remains under investigation.
The Iowa State Patrol was assisted by the Cedar County Sheriff’s Office, Tipton Police Department, Clarence Fire, and Lowden Fire Department.
